The ICA in London has been at the forefront of cutting edge ideas and has been hosting the very successful Pecha Kucha evenings. Now it is the turn of another new idea to play centre stage.
Flypitch is the name of the new event and it’s basically an informal way for talented young designers to showcase their work and try to get it made. Designers turn-up with a suitcase full of their own stuff and then explain it. Each designer will talk for about ten minutes before the audience gets to ask questions.
Speakers confirmed so far include Committee, Doshi Levien, Nik Roope (Hulger), Troika, Tracey Neuls, Random International, Diplo Magazine, Moritz Waldemeyer, &Made and Max Lamb plus more TBC.
The show is on 23 September at the London Design Embassy within the ICA and runs from 2pm to 6pm.
